Stock Market Outlook for a Bull Run

As investors and market enthusiasts keep a vigilant eye on financial markets, the possibility of a new bull run in the stock market is a topic of significant interest. A bull run is characterized by rising stock prices and an overall optimistic market sentiment, and predicting such a phase requires careful analysis of various economic indicators, market trends, and geopolitical factors. This article delves into the elements that might contribute to a bullish stock market outlook in the near future.

Economic Indicators Pointing to Growth

The backbone of any bull run is a strong economy. Key economic indicators, such as GDP growth, employment rates, and consumer spending, provide valuable insights into the overall health of the economy. When these indicators show positive trends, they often signal a conducive environment for a bull market. Recently, there has been encouraging news on multiple fronts:

  • Gross Domestic Product (GDP): Several leading economies are experiencing robust GDP growth, fueled by technological advancements and increased consumer confidence. This growth is a prime factor for rising stock prices.
  • Employment and Wages: Low unemployment rates and rising wages increase disposable income, bolstering consumer spending and corporate profits, which in turn positively impact stock valuations.
  • Inflation Rates: Moderated inflation rates coupled with proactive central bank policies can create a stable investment environment, making equities more attractive.

Corporate Earnings and Innovations

Corporate performance is another critical determinant of stock market trends. Companies reporting strong earnings and engaging in innovative ventures often drive market optimism:

  • Earnings Reports: Quarterly earnings releases from major corporations have shown better-than-expected performance across various sectors. Tech giants, in particular, continue to dominate with substantial revenue growths due to their critical role in digital transformation.
  • Innovations and R&D: Significant investments in Research & Development (R&D) and the advent of breakthrough technologies like artificial intelligence, renewable energy, and biotech are paving the way for future growth, thereby fueling investor confidence.

Market Sentiment and Investor Confidence

Market sentiment, a measure of the overall attitude of investors toward a particular security or financial market, plays a crucial role in sustaining a bull run. When investors are confident, they are more likely to invest, leading to a self-reinforcing cycle of rising stock prices:

  • Capital Inflows: There has been a noticeable increase in capital inflows into equity markets, with both retail and institutional investors showing heightened interest. This liquidity is fundamental to maintaining upward momentum.
  • Policy and Regulatory Environment: Investor sentiment is often buoyed by favorable government policies and regulations. Recent tax reforms and supportive monetary policies by central banks around the world are creating a positive environment for equity investments.

Geopolitical Stability and Global Trade

Geopolitical stability and a conducive global trade environment are also critical factors contributing to a bull run in the stock market. Trade agreements, diplomatic relations, and international cooperation can significantly impact investor confidence and market performance:

  • Trade Agreements: Recent strides in resolving trade disputes and the formation of new trade agreements have reduced global trade tensions, providing a stable backdrop for economic growth and market performance.
  • Geopolitical Events: Stability in key geopolitical regions and the absence of major conflicts contribute to an overall sense of security in global markets, promoting steady investment flows.
